Hankook Ventus Sport K104's
general advisory practice for tyres is replace at 5 years old, so 10 year old tyres are past their use by date. but i know very few people who actually bother with that ;-) as long as they have been stored indoors, they are probably fine, but the rubber may not be as pliable as new tyres
-
Hankook Ventus Sport K104's
not tried that specific model, but had Hankooks on a few different cars now in the dry they were great, and mileage was good, but i dont find them that good in the wet, and they always seem noisy on the road. personally, i wouldnt consider them for a daily driver, but would use them for a weekend/summer car.
